The Village
Molesworth is a well-placed and attractive village, with a parish church, active village hall, Millennium playing field and tennis courts. Further amenities can be found at the nearby market towns of Kimbolton and Thrapston. The nearest primary school is around a mile away at Brington which in turn is a feeder for Hinchingbrooke Secondary School in Huntingdon. Conveniently situated for road and rail use, main routes such as the A1, newly upgraded A14 and the A428 are all within easy reach, with nearby Bedford, Huntingdon and St Neots offering mainline stations and commuter service to London. The airports of Stansted, Luton and East Midlands can be reached in a little over an hour.
